wondernero.blogg.se

Linux smartgit
Linux smartgit








  1. Linux smartgit mac os#
  2. Linux smartgit install#
  3. Linux smartgit full#
  4. Linux smartgit software#
  5. Linux smartgit code#

Linux smartgit software#

Software Sources Ltd is Syntevo’s Reseller. Integrate DeepGit with any IDE which supports external tools: Eclipse, Visual Studio, IntelliJ Idea, … and powerful text editors like Sublime.

Linux smartgit code#

DeepGit will detect code movements, even if lines are not identical.ĭeepGit is free to use for everyone, even in a commercial environment. It is based on git blame and makes it easy to trace changes to a line or block of code. It does not know about platform-dependent file attributes like executable flags or permissions.Īnswer the question “why is this code there?” more effectively than with conventional Git clients.ĭeepGit is a tool to investigate the history of source code. SmartSynchronize is not designed as a backup tool or for synchronizing with remote hosts, e.g.

  • support for all major text file encodings.
  • configurable font, colors and accelerators.
  • linux smartgit

  • command line interface for easy invocation from other applications.
  • easy merge from changed files to resulting files.
  • ability to edit each of the three files.
  • automatic synchronization depending on file times and previous synchronization time.
  • saving configuration for later re-use (“profile”).
  • easy transfer of changes from one directory structure to another.
  • configurable filter for customized directory scanning (inclusion and exclusion).
  • comfortable editing and transfer of changes from one file to the other.
  • SmartSynchronize is optimized for comparing directory structures (for example, of software projects), and can keep them synchronized. It allows you to compare files or perform 3-way-merges, both with the ability to edit the file contents. SmartSynchronize is a multi-platform file and directory compare tool. SmartSynchronize is an advanced file and directory compare tool. SmartGit comes with special integrations for GitHub, BitBucket and BitBucket Server (former Atlassian Stash) to create and resolve Pull Requests and Review Comments.
  • External or built-in Compare or Conflict Solver tools,.
  • You can customize SmartGit in various ways:

    linux smartgit

    The platform supports Windows, Linux, and macOS and features an intuitive.

  • command line Git client (Windows, macOS)Ī commercial Git client should support your work-flows. SmartGit is a top choice if youre looking for a multi-platform Git GUI client.
  • Linux smartgit install#

    No need to install and configure additional tools. Use your SmartGit license on as many machines and operating systems you like. drag and drop commit reordering, merging or rebase.Update: Since SmartGit/Hg 4.6, you can configure multiple Directory tools in the Preferences. This powerful, multi-platform Git client has the same intuitive user interface on Windows, macOS and Linux: SmartGit/Hg 4.5 (and older) do not offer to start the git command line, however you may configure the 'Directory Tool' (Preferences, Tools) to open a terminal (or DOS box), so you can invoke the command line quickly. SmartGit runs on Windows, macOS and Linux. I doubt you would will be disappointed.SmartGit is a graphical Git client with support for GitHub, Bitbucket and GitLab.

    Linux smartgit full#

    I’m not going to do a full and comparative review as this product is free for non-commercial use, so just download a copy and take it for a test drive yourself. I’ve used a couple of other git GUIs and merging and rebasing in them just not seem intuitive and the speed of their interfaces when dealing with a repo as large as Mono is killing me and I’ve ended up back in the cmd line. The SmartGui interface just works walking the source tree, staging/unstaging, ours/theirs resolver, 3-way visual resolver/merge, markdown support, Github integration, etc… is just fast and clean and once you learn a few keystroke shortcuts that merge do done in a heartbeat.

    linux smartgit

    When you are looking at hundreds of commits, and in a couple of cases, thousands of changes in between release tags and branches of Mono, doing that via the cmd line is doable, but it will give you nightmares. When you are merging or rebasing hundreds of changing, doing that by hand from the cmd line is dreadful… I’ve been merging the newer branches of Mono into PlayScript and it can be painful since the Apache open-source version PlayScript was pulled by Zynga from Github two years ago without warning. Commercial licenses seem to be very reasonable and on par with other commercial git products.

    linux smartgit

    Linux smartgit mac os#

    And the best thing is SmartGit is free for non-commercial use and runs on Mac OS X, Windows and Linux. Syntevo’s SmartGit is a Git client with Mercurial and Subversion support, and while I can not comment on its mg or svn support, its git and GitHub support is amazing.










    Linux smartgit